3. INSTALLATION OF THE APPLIANCE
The installation, and counterpart connections, the activation and check of proper function must be followed
faithfully, according to the rules of your country and the given instructions.
The placement of the appliance near wood, freezers, plastic parts of furniture and other flammable materials is
FORBIDDEN, because of high temperatures development. The minimum distance between the heater and any other
object should be 50cm, and between the heater and flammable materials 80cm.
In case the surface, where the heater is placed, is flammable (wood, parquet etc.), the existence of a metal plaque in
between the heater and the floor is NECESSARΥ. The plaque should me extended by 10cm on each side of the
heater and 80cm on the front side.
Air-conditioning and ventilation appliances that function in the room, where the heater is placed, may cause troubling
with its function that should be arranged.
The diameter of the pipes must be equal to the diameter of the heater's exit. The heater must be connected to the
chimney with stove pipes. The pipe shouldn’t be placed too deep into The chimney, for prevention of the reduction of
the flue outlet diameter. The horizontal pipes should have a slight upward inclination and the vertical pipes should be
upright, although horizontal arrangement should be avoided for maximum efficiency of the appliance. The last pipe on
the inside of the room, where the heater is placed, should be warm enough, for prevention of liquefaction of waste gas
that may lead to fluid leakage in the house.
The external pipes and the chimney should be tightly fixed. The pipes should have a vertical finish and be higher than
any other obstacle around. The existence of a
Η-shaped pipe at the end is necessary. The part of the pipe, which is
on the outside of the house should be insulated for the maintenance of temperature and the prevention of liquefaction
of waste gas. The temperature of the waste gas is 240° C. The waste gases contain liquid elements with different
chemical composition and density, depending on the type of the fuel. These liquid elements cause liquefaction on the
inside of the chimney. In case of wood combustion, what is formed is creosote which is non-toxic, but there is the
danger of ignition.
4. FUNCTION OF THE APPLIANCE
The proven heat power was determined after research and development in the laboratories of
Gekas Metal.
It was
relied on mathematical models and confirmed by TTC ltd (European certificate center). To be achieved important
factors are, carefully selected fuels with the necessary efficiency and humidity, constant refilling, primary and
secondary air moderation, as well as traction.
The use of SG line heaters presupposes the existence of a chimney.
Start the lighting, by placing twigs (tinder) in the combustion chamber, starting a small fire for the prevention of thermal
shock. The primary and the secondary air moderators are open. To add more fuels in the heater make sure that the
previous amount of fuels has been burned. Close the two air moderators. In case of
SG1200
, after the closing of the
two air moderators (primary and secondary) open the afterburning moderator. Do not let the rack clog with remains
and unburned substances. Clean the rack regularly. Open the door slowly, carefully and not abruptly, allowing the
equalization of pressures in the combustion area and the room, otherwise fumes may leak out. The heater is designed
for functioning with the door of the combustion area constantly closed, unless when fuels are added. Do not open the
door unnecessarily. For maximum efficiency, the wood should have 20% maximum humidity, otherwise tar and fumes
are developed, which create creosote.
Also, it should be mentioned that the appearance of large or smaller cracks on the firebricks is absolutely normal,
even after the first use of the heater. This is caused by the phase difference of the materials' expansion (metal-
firebrick) and it doesn't affect the efficiency and function of the product. The firebricks endure up to seven (7), if they
remain in their place, despite the cracks they may develop.
Traction is the basic principle for proper function of the heater. It is achieved by the difference between atmospheric
pressure and pressure of the combustion point. The better the traction of the chimney is, the bigger the dimensions of
the door can be. In cases of lower traction, such as when we have more horizontal pipes than vertical, we are facing
the problem with the burning of twigs or paper, in order to achieve the heating of the chimney, i.e. gradual increase of
atmospheric pressure. The waste gas valve should remain open during the heating of the chimney, while you can
close it after that for cost-effectiveness.
